You are not logged in.

wcf.regNote.message

piep001

Intermediate

  • "piep001" started this thread

Posts: 338

Location: NRW

Occupation: Fachinformatiker (AE)

  • Send private message

1

Wednesday, January 12th 2005, 9:47am

FreePascal :: Verzeichnis auf Existenz prüfen + u.U. anlegen

Weiß jemand, wie ich prüfen kann, ob ein bestimmtes Verzeichnis existiert und wie ich es, wenn es nicht vorhanden ist, anlegen kann?

Die Unit "DOS" scheint dafür ein paar Funktionen bereit zu halten und wie es rein theoretisch geht, weiß ich auch, aber vielleicht hat ja einer ne gute Idee oder kennt feritge Funktionen!?!

Ein mögliches Verzeichnis könnte z.B. sein:
C:\test\programme\test\

Ich möchte rekursiv jeden einzelnen Ordner testen und ihn anlegen, falls er nicht vorhanden ist.
Spaß im Netz auf www.piep001.de

This post has been edited 2 times, last edit by "piep001" (Jan 12th 2005, 9:50am)


Prometheus

Administrator

Posts: 3,278

  • Send private message

2

Wednesday, January 12th 2005, 1:52pm

wenn ich das noch richtig in erinnerung hab gibt es ne filesystem classe welche genau die funktionen und ein paar mehr bereit stellt. du kannst da wie du geschrieben hast den kompletten pfad angeben und es werden alle unterverzeichnisse erstellt die fehlen. dummerweise hab ich die unterlagen nicht mehr wo das mit pascal drin war. als delphi kam dachte ich pascal is eh geschichte ...
Jedwege Anfragen bitte an Technomausi oder ShaoKhan richten. Dieses Konto ist und bleibt inaktiv.

piep001

Intermediate

  • "piep001" started this thread

Posts: 338

Location: NRW

Occupation: Fachinformatiker (AE)

  • Send private message

3

Wednesday, January 12th 2005, 3:14pm

Genau sowas brauche ich.
Mir würde momentan auch schon reichen, wenn ich checken könnte, ob es die Ordner gibt.

Würde auch gerne Delphie benutzen, aber Chefe ist da anderer Ansicht. ;(
Spaß im Netz auf www.piep001.de

wcf.user.socialbookmarks.titel